张老师: "小李,咱们学校最近要建一个智慧校园系统,听说需要用到PHP,你觉得这个语言适合吗?"
小李: "当然可以!PHP非常适合用来构建Web应用,比如我们学校的在线课程平台、学生管理系统之类的。它简单易学,社区资源也很丰富。"
张老师: "那具体来说,PHP能解决哪些问题呢?"
小李: "首先,我们可以用PHP来搭建数据库驱动的应用程序。像学生信息管理、成绩查询等功能都可以通过PHP连接MySQL数据库实现。而且,PHP支持多种数据格式的API接口,这样就能方便地与其他系统对接了。"
张老师: "听起来不错。不过,安全性和性能怎么样?毕竟涉及到大量敏感数据。"
小李: "确实需要重视。使用PHP时,我们可以采用参数化查询防止SQL注入,同时加密传输数据保护隐私。至于性能,合理优化代码结构和服务器配置是关键。另外,还可以引入缓存机制减少数据库压力。"
张老师: "明白了,那对于前端交互这部分,你有什么建议?"
小李: "我们可以结合HTML5、CSS3以及JavaScript框架(如Vue.js)打造响应式界面,确保用户无论是在电脑还是手机上都能流畅访问。PHP负责后端逻辑处理,前后端分离有助于分工协作。"
张老师: "好的,看来我们需要组建一个跨部门团队,包括IT人员和技术开发者共同推进项目。你觉得大概需要多长时间完成初步版本?"
小李: "如果需求明确且资源充足的话,大概半年到一年应该可以推出一个基础版。之后再根据反馈逐步迭代更新功能模块。"
张老师: "嗯,这计划听起来可行。谢谢你的分析,接下来我们就按照这个方向去准备吧!"
小李: "不客气,希望我们的努力能让校园更加智能化!"
]]>